• Develop and implement strategic, integrated, multi-channel marketing campaigns targeting CA, FL, and TX K–12 audiences (district leaders, administrators, IT decision-makers, and educators) aligned with business objectives and sales priorities • Identify market opportunities based on state initiatives, funding, legislation, and priorities within K–12 education • Plan and lead campaign calendars, ensuring timely launch and execution across channels • Create annual and quarterly campaign plans for priority states. • Monitor market trends, competitive activity, and customer needs • Collaborate with product marketing to craft compelling, education-focused messaging and value propositions • Ensure campaigns reflect K–12 trends such as digital transformation, student outcomes, equity initiatives, and compliance requirements • Guide content development including emails, landing pages, webinars, white papers, case studies, and thought leadership assets for designated states • Collaborate with Demand and Central Marketing to implement campaigns across multiple channels, including: Email marketing, Paid media (digital ads, social, search), Events and webinars, Account-based marketing (ABM), Partner and field marketing • Optimize channel mix based on performance data and audience insights • Partner closely with K–12 sales teams to align campaigns with territory priorities and pipeline goals • Support account-based strategies and provide campaign toolkits for sales enablement • Gather field feedback to refine targeting, messaging, and campaign effectiveness • Define key performance indicators and success metrics for each campaign (e.g., MQLs, SQLs, pipeline contribution, and return on investment) • Monitor campaign performance and optimize in real time • Provide regular reporting and insights to marketing and business partners • Leverage marketing automation and CRM tools to track engagement and conversion • Develop a deep understanding of the K–12 education landscape, including: Budget cycles and funding sources, Key buying roles and decision-making processes, Competitive landscape and industry trends • Stay current on education policy and emerging needs impacting schools
•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ience in Marketing, Business, Communications, or related field • Minimum of 3 years of B2B marketing experience, preferably in education, EdTech, or public sector • Confirmed experience leading integrated marketing campaigns end-to-end, with state adoption experience preferred • Strong understanding of demand generation, lead lifecycle, and funnel metrics • Experience working with CRM and marketing automation platforms • Experience marketing to K–12 school districts or education institutions preferred • Familiarity with account-based marketing (ABM) strategies preferred • Knowledge of K–12 procurement and funding models preferred • Ability to translate complex solutions into clear, compelling messaging preferred • Ability to travel up to 25% for conferences, events, and customer meetings
